About

This Introduction to Slow Fashion and Sustainable Practices short course at the University of the Arts London (UAL) is an introduction to slow, sustainable fashion. You'll become familiar with ethical business models, slow-fashion's unique selling points, right through to how to market slow fashion on social media.

Overview

On this four-week Introduction to Slow Fashion and Sustainable Practices course at the University of the Arts London (UAL) we will examine why sustainable living practices and slow fashion go hand in hand.

About the course

  • We will discuss why there is a growth in sustainable practice jobs and business opportunities across retail and service industry sectors.
  • Embracing diversity, accepting that we are all individuals and that as a collective whole we can make a difference is part of the power of the Slow Lifestyle conscious consumerism movement. Respecting that circularity in all things from food to fashion means respecting our planet, mirroring nature’s sustainable cycles.
  • Through a combination of discussions, short lectures, inspirational case studies, introduction to tools, and practical application of tools through hands-on assignment briefs we will explore why slow living and slow fashion has become so attractive to us as consumers. 
  • We’ll look at the history past to present, asking who the movers and shakers are in this area and how can we learn from them to build our own mindful sustainable lifestyle at home, at work, and in our business practice. Students will be expected to work one or two hours outside of class.

Programme Structure

Topics covered:
  • Slow fashion’s circular practices
  • Exploring fast fashion’s flaws
  • Introduction to strategies for slow living sustainable practices
  • Research into Greenwashing
  • Careers in sustainable practice
  • Visual literacy – the circular economy image
  • Learning from nature: waste as a resource
  • Analysis - do we think or feel mindful consumerism?
  • Social media’s role in spreading the word
  • A waste not want not economy – can it work?

Other requirements

General requirements

  • This course is aimed at designers, creatives, managers and entrepreneurs in the creative industries interested in conscious consumerism.
  • It is also an excellent fit for individuals who are new to the creative sector or who aspire to work in it, and want to learn more about slow fashion and sustainable practices.
